desktop

[Tutorial] y manejo de Proton IDE

hola que tal amigos les cuento que llevo mas de 1 año trabajando con proton IDE y es de lo mejor en la actualidad trabajo con Glcd samsung y toshiba y han respondido muy bien, hay un par de cosas que aun no he logrado con ellas pero estoy seguro que mas adelante lo lograre que rico encontrar este foro y sobretodo encontrar gente de Colombia, bueno amigos en unos días voy ha postear unos ejemplitos para el manejo de las Glcds felices Pascuas.....
 
Última edición por un moderador:
Hola a todos.
pipo12 que modelo de Glcd Toshiba has probado? t6963? Lo pregunto por que tengo una pantalla de estas y no consigo comunicarme bien con un pic + proton. No sé si Mecatrodatos incorporará ejemplos de esta pantalla gráfica en su , magnífico, tutorial que esta haciendo.
Un saludo a todos...
 
Saludos aqui nuevamente, parece que el foro se quedó muerto....
de todas formas me gustaría saber si alguien ha hecho un diseño para controlar un motor brushless ya que me gustaría adaptarle uno a mi bicicleta pero por motivos de presupuesto no he podido hacerme al comercial pues es caro, he visto alguna información sobre el motor que es entendible, pero respecto al control, sigo muy confundido y agradecería cualquier orientación respecto al tema. Adjunto algo que encotré en la red, me parece que le falta mucho en programación pues lo ideal sería un control pid para manejar bien las variables de velocidad-torque y viceversa.

Como siempre, mil y mas gracias
 

Adjuntos

  • Pistas para reparar una bicicleta eléctrica con motor.rar
    224 KB · Visitas: 173
Muy divertido lo del bote, no es difícil controlar 2 motores con modulos rf genericos pues logré hacerlos funcionar, lo que no sé es si se puedan controlar al mismo tiempo con la programación en basic, para este caso sería uno para el impulsor y otro para la dirección, bueno, al menos eso creo.
 
Si... que bien, me gustaría saber cómo, si eso te parece bien, claro, yo controlé unos pap pero, segun mi código, no podía pulsar para activar ambos al mismo tiempo porq se manejaba con una condición If, como no supe hacerle, desistí de armar un carrito rc pues perdía calidad en el trabajo.
 
en el #120 hay un archivo rar , en el se encuentra la simulacion en proteus juntos con los hex. tanto del emisor como receptor y por supuesto los codigo fuente.


saludos
 
Ah... super bueno, lo chequearé pues me interesa... muchas gracias por tu ayuda.

Sí, es cierto, no lo había checado, ahora pretendo construir mi rc basandome en dicha información.
Suerte!
 
Última edición:
Bueno falto más especificaciones pero lo preparé así:
- Oscilador externo de 20Mhz.
- Pulsador de boot en RC7; igual al esquema que puse anteriormente (entra al modo boot cuando el pulsador está presionado).
- Led que indica actividad del boot en RB7.

Pasos:
1) Grabas el firmware HID Bootloader PIC18 Non J.hex en el PIC con otro programador.
2) Colocas al PIC en la placa de aplicación.
3) Conectas el cable USB o reinicias al PIC pero teniendo presionado el pulsador para que el PIC entre en el modo Boot. Aquí la primera vez el sistema te debe avisar que se a detectado un nuevo dispositivo "Instalando el driver" o algo así; esperas a que termine "Instalado satisfactoriamente" o algo así y listo.
4) Puedes soltar el pulsador que solo es necesario al momento de conectar el cable USB o luego del reset del PIC.
5) Abres el programa HIDBootLoader (si ya está abierto, este reconoce si el PIC se a conectado o desconectado); este debe indicar que a reconocido al dispositivo. Al reconocerlo se habilitan los botones "Open Hex File", Program/Verifi, etc...
6) Luego de grabar el firmware de prueba por medio del bootloader se puede usar el botón "Reset Device" del programa que reiniciará al PIC y sin presionar el pulsador de boot para que vaya a ejecutar directamente el firmware de prueba.
7) Cada vez que quieras grabar otro firmware por medio del bootloader debes repetir los pasos desde el punto (3).

Hola ByAxel, tengo realizada una entrenadora para un 18F2550 con un pulsador para boot en RC7 y un led indicador de actividad para el boot también en RC6. No logro modificar y compilar el programa bootloader para adaptarlo a esta configuración. ¿serías tan amable de realizar esta pequeña modificación en el firmware? Tan solo se trataría de cambiar el led de RB7 a RC6 ya que el resto de la configuración es la que tengo (20 Mhz, Pulsador de boot en RC7). Muchas gracias anticpadas
 
hola con todos tengo dudas de como usar las instrucciones while---wend, si me podrian explicar algo de como usar me seria de mucha ayuda.
gracias por la ayuda de antemano
 
gracias por el video muy explicativo me aclaro muchas dudas.
Tengo ahora un problema, paso el programa al pic, hice la simulación de mi programa en proteus y esta bien.
LO armo en el proto y cuando alimento al circuito no funciona nada, no se por que.
Aaa.. por cierto el circuito hace papadear un led y cuando pulso un pulsante hace parpadear otro led.
disculpen las molestias y de nuevo gracias por la ayuda de antemano.
Adjunto la simulación en proteus y los archivos .HEX y .bas

no se alguien porfa podria subir un tutorial de como grabar la programación que haces en el pic creo que esa es la parte donde estoy fallando. gracias de antemano:oops:
 

Adjuntos

  • Encendido de 2 leds.rar
    6.7 KB · Visitas: 141
Última edición:
Atrás
Arriba